全加器电路练习

void setup()
{
  pinMode(2, OUTPUT); 
  pinMode(3, OUTPUT);
  pinMode(4, OUTPUT); //CIN
  Serial.begin(9600);
}

void loop()
{
  digitalWrite(2, LOW);
  digitalWrite(3, LOW);
  digitalWrite(4, LOW);
  Serial.println("A=0, B=0, Cin=0");
  delay(2000);
  
  digitalWrite(2, LOW);
  digitalWrite(3, LOW);
  digitalWrite(4, HIGH);
  Serial.println("A=0, B=0, Cin=1");
  delay(2000);
  
  digitalWrite(2, LOW);
  digitalWrite(3, HIGH);
  digitalWrite(4, LOW);
  Serial.println("A=0, B=1, Cin=0");
  delay(2000);
  
  digitalWrite(2, LOW);
  digitalWrite(3, HIGH);
  digitalWrite(4, HIGH);
  Serial.println("A=0, B=1, Cin=1");
  delay(2000);
  
  digitalWrite(2, HIGH);
  digitalWrite(3, LOW);
  digitalWrite(4, LOW);
  Serial.println("A=1, B=0, Cin=0");
  delay(2000);
  
  digitalWrite(2, HIGH);
  digitalWrite(3, LOW);
  digitalWrite(4, HIGH);
  Serial.println("A=1, B=0, Cin=1");
  delay(2000);
  
  digitalWrite(2, HIGH);
  digitalWrite(3, HIGH);
  digitalWrite(4, LOW);
  Serial.println("A=1, B=1, Cin=0");
  delay(2000);
  
  digitalWrite(2, HIGH);
  digitalWrite(3, HIGH);
  digitalWrite(4, HIGH);
  Serial.println("A=1, B=1, Cin=1");
  delay(2000);
   
}
SHXJ
Latest posts by SHXJ (see all)

发布留言